		<description>I was very glad to find your php google maps api.  I am using the multi marker here

http://www.bradwedell.com/phpgooglemapapi/demos/multiple_markers_coords.php

But would like the default view to be map, not satellite, and zoomed out to the maximum, can you please tell me what settings or code I need for that?  Thank you very much in advance.

		<description>Jack - in order to get the latest source, you must visit the &quot;source&quot; tab.  Currently, you must checkout the source using SVN since there are so many updates going on.  Once I&#039;ve gotten the library to a &quot;stable&quot; point, I&#039;ll be adding the files to a downloadable .zip file, but until then, it&#039;s probably a good idea to stay up to date with the latest version.  Personally, I use TortoiseSVN as a great GUI Window client.</description>
